Feb 4, 2019 at 10:30 PM Post #258 of 663
Does the iFi iUSB3.0 have the correct power for a Hugo 2 if i use the usb power from that device to charge/run in desktop mode? i dont want to blow up the Hugo 2 or underpower it :p

also would i benefit from a Curious Cable Type A to Type B cable between the iGalvanic and iUSB3.0?
1. iusb has enough power to run hugo2 in desktop mode
2. The cable from PC to galvanic matters.... you'll require usb3.0 type B which is diff. from usb 2.0. I had mercury usb3.0 cables to connect pc to galvanic & galvanic to iusb3.0. Definitely made a diff over stock ones.

Apr 6, 2019 at 8:03 AM Post #270 of 663
Can you please shoot us a message here: http://support.ifi-audio.com/

We'll try to help you there. Thanks!
Hi, Ok. Seriously my bad. 24 hrs later the violet desktop mode light came on. I obviously get confused with all the colourful lights on the hugo2.
So now I can recommend the device for use with the hugo2. Yes the sound quality is bettered...I am also using the igalvanic 3 with it. The two together are an audible improvement over stock hugo2.
